LAWMAKERS urged Davao City First District Paolo “Pulong” Duterte to appear before Congress and defend his proposed bill requiring government officials to undergo mandatory random drug testing through a hair follicle drug test.
In a statement, Puwersa ng Bayaning Atleta Partylist Rep. Margarita “Atty. Migs” Nograles said that while Duterte has the right to file the bill, he should personally defend it in committee and plenary sessions rather than delegating it to another congressman.
“There is a Supreme Court case already that deemed mandatory drug testing unconstitutional if it’s included as one of the qualifications for a candidate, as the Constitution itself determines those qualifications,” Nograles said.She also pointed out that it would be unconstitutional if the proposed measure singles out specific individuals, noting that such a policy should apply uniformly across all levels of government, including local government units .
